The Astronomy Driving Limitless Day and Endless Night time
The phenomena of unlimited daylight and extended darkness are direct implications of Earth’s axial tilt and orbital mechanics. Earth is tilted roughly 23.five levels relative on the aircraft of its orbit across the Sun. This tilt—not the space through the Sunlight—is the main driver of seasonal variation. As Earth revolves annually within the Sunshine, distinct hemispheres alternately tilt toward or clear of incoming photo voltaic radiation, generating shifts in each temperature and working day size.
At latitudes over sixty six.five° north and south—recognized respectively as the Arctic Circle plus the Antarctic Circle—the tilt has an extreme outcome. For the duration of nearby summer, the pole tilts towards the Sun adequately that solar declination continues to be large enough for that Sunlight to remain previously mentioned the horizon for a full 24 hrs or more. This ongoing illumination is called the midnight Sunshine. The closer just one moves for the pole, the longer the length of uninterrupted daylight. At the geographic poles by themselves, the Solar rises after at the spring equinox and stays obvious, tracing a sluggish round route within the sky, till it sets at the autumn equinox—causing about 6 months of daylight.
The reverse occurs during community winter. Any time a pole tilts from the Solar, solar declination results in being insufficient to convey the Sunshine previously mentioned the horizon. This creates polar night time, a period of time in the course of which the Sunlight does not increase in any respect. All over again, duration boosts with latitude. Near the poles, darkness can persist for months, even though it is not absolute; civil twilight should supply dim illumination depending upon the Sun’s angle down below the horizon.
The main element astronomical variable governing these extremes is solar declination—the angular placement of your Sun relative to Earth’s equatorial plane. As declination oscillates involving +23.five° and −23.5° throughout the year, locations close to the poles periodically enter zones where Earth’s curvature prevents sunrise or sunset from developing.
These patterns are mathematically predictable and repeat every year with precision. Still their experiential consequences—months outlined by an individual dawn or sunset—reveal how a modest axial tilt generates a few of the Earth’s most spectacular environmental contrasts.
Organic Clocks Less than Strain
Human physiology is organized close to circadian rhythms—endogenous, somewhere around 24-hour cycles controlled via the suprachiasmatic nucleus (SCN) within the hypothalamus. This inner pacemaker synchronizes bodily processes for example hormone secretion, snooze–wake timing, Main temperature, metabolism, and cognitive alertness. Its Most important environmental cue, or zeitgeber, is light-weight. Under common situations, the day-to-day pattern of sunrise and sunset reinforces circadian alignment. In regions experiencing midnight Solar or polar night time, that exterior sign gets distorted or disappears entirely.
In the course of periods of continuous daylight, publicity to persistent light-weight suppresses melatonin secretion, the hormone to blame for selling rest onset. With out a very clear signal of darkness, people today generally practical experience delayed snooze phases, insomnia, and fragmented relaxation. Your body’s inner clock might drift afterwards every single day, making a type of “social jet lag,” specially when get the job done schedules continue to be set. Cortisol rhythms, normally peaking each morning to advertise alertness, can flatten or change, impacting Power regulation and temper security.
Conversely, prolonged darkness through polar evening reduces gentle-mediated stimulation in the SCN. Lower light-weight intensity—particularly during the blue spectrum—can dampen circadian amplitude and lead to hypersomnia, lethargy, and reduced cognitive sharpness. Seasonal Affective Dysfunction (SAD) is a lot more prevalent at better latitudes, reflecting how diminished photoperiod influences serotonin action and temper regulation. Artificial light-weight turns into a therapeutic intervention rather than a usefulness; timed vibrant-gentle exposure is frequently prescribed to stabilize circadian timing.
Beyond snooze and temper, metabolic processes are influenced. Circadian misalignment is affiliated with impaired glucose regulation, appetite disruption, and altered immune purpose. For communities living beneath extreme photoperiods, structured routines—mounted slumber schedules, controlled mild publicity, and deliberate darkness throughout relaxation durations—serve as compensatory mechanisms.
Importantly, adaptation happens. People of higher-latitude areas normally build behavioral tactics that buffer biological strain: blackout curtains in summer season, light-weight therapy in winter, and culturally embedded routines that impose temporal construction when pure cues are unreliable. However, the strain is actual. The circadian procedure evolved below predictable cycles of sunshine and dim; when those cycles lengthen to weeks or months, biology ought to negotiate between environmental extremes and internal equilibrium.

Architecture, Style and design, and Constructed Setting
In locations defined by midnight Sunlight and polar evening, architecture is not really merely aesthetic—it really is adaptive infrastructure. Properties will have to compensate for environmental extremes that disrupt biological rhythm, psychological balance, and each day operation. The built setting will become a mediating layer between celestial mechanics and human habitability.
Light management is central. In regions of constant daylight, household and business buildings often incorporate blackout techniques, layered curtains, and adjustable shading to simulate nighttime. Bedrooms are made as managed darkness zones, enabling circadian alignment even though the outside continues to be dazzling. Conversely, during polar night, architecture prioritizes light amplification. Big south-dealing with windows (inside the Northern Hemisphere), reflective interior surfaces, and strategic artificial lighting methods increase obtainable illumination. Substantial-lux, entire-spectrum lighting is usually utilised indoors to counteract seasonal mood decrease and sustain alertness.
Thermal efficiency is equally crucial. Intense cold during extended darkness requires remarkable insulation, triple-glazed Home windows, airtight envelopes, and heat recovery ventilation units. Electrical power-economical style and design will not be optional—it decides survival and economic sustainability. Compact urban scheduling cuts down warmth reduction and exposure, though interconnected properties let movement with out constant publicity to significant climate.
Color and product alternative also affect psychological nicely-being. In very long winters, interiors typically characteristic warm tones, pure wood, and tactile materials that counteract environmental austerity. General public spaces may include vibrant façades to offset monochromatic landscapes dominated by snow or darkness. During infinite summer season light, shading equipment, deep overhangs, and cool-toned interiors average sensory intensity.
City layout adapts also. Avenue lighting in polar night time need to balance basic safety with visual comfort and ease, staying away from glare versus snow and ice. Community accumulating spaces come to be anchors of social cohesion, compensating for seasonal isolation. In large-latitude towns including Tromsø and Reykjavík, civic planning intentionally integrates cultural venues, Wintertime festivals, and pedestrian-pleasant layouts to maintain activity Even with climatic constraints.
Ultimately, architecture in Excessive latitudes performs a regulatory function. It restores rhythm the place mother nature withholds it, softens environmental severity, and constructs psychological continuity. In doing so, the designed atmosphere gets not just shelter, but a deliberate extension of human adaptation to astronomical extremes.
